I have received several calls claiming to be eBay over the past two weeks. Is this a scam caller or eBay?
I cannot edit my reply any more, but I forgot to say that eBay does not "just" call customers. If they do, they also send an email.
You should not engage with anyone claiming to be eBay support on the phone.
IMMEDIATELY hang up, and check on eBay for a message.
The “eBay call” is a very well-known scam. It is the same (basically) as the “Amazon call” scam, the “bank account call” scam, the “solar rebate call” scam, the “tax office call” scam, etc.
Scammers have taken to posting on eBay forums posing as innocent confirmers of fake support numbers.
I reiterate: it’s a scam. It’s a scam. It’s a scam. Only ever contact eBay via the contact details on eBay’s own site.
